Ordinals
beta
Sat 873301977422803
decimal
174660.1977422803
degree
0°174660′1284″1977422803‴
percentile
41.58580849444931%
name
hqxexvrqeiw
cycle
0
epoch
0
period
86
block
174660
offset
1977422803
timestamp
2012-04-07 14:34:17 UTC
rarity
common
prev
next